Meghan Markle and Prince Harry stepped out for a rare public appearance in Canada last Friday, joining the David Foster Foundation’s 40th Anniversary Celebration in Victoria, British Columbia. The couple, known for keeping their day-to-day life largely private, appeared visibly at ease throughout the evening, sharing laughs on the red carpet before settling in for a night of music and celebration. By the time the performances began, Markle had traded her composed red-carpet pose for something far more spontaneous, giving fans a side of the Duchess they rarely see documented so publicly.
A Glamorous Night in Victoria
The gala, hosted by music producer David Foster, brought together entertainers and philanthropists for an evening supporting music therapy programs. Harry and Markle arrived together, posing for photographers before taking their seats for a program that included a live set from Maroon 5 frontman Adam Levine. Onlookers described the atmosphere as warm and celebratory, a fitting backdrop for the couple’s latest joint outing since stepping back from royal duties.

A Fashion Statement With Royal Ties
Markle turned heads in an off-the-shoulder black gown from Canadian label Greta Constantine, its floor-length silhouette punctuated by a dramatic cape draped over one shoulder. She kept her beauty look understated, opting for soft makeup and a sleek updo that let the dress take center stage. Her jewelry, though, carried the evening’s most talked-about detail: sapphire-and-diamond earrings that once belonged to Princess Diana, paired with her engagement ring and a stack of gold bracelets. Harry matched her formality in a classic black tuxedo, rounding out a coordinated look for their night out and reinforcing the pair’s tendency to weave subtle nods to his late mother into their public appearances.
The Dance That Sparked Debate
As Levine’s set filled the room, cameras caught Markle breaking into an impromptu dance beside her seat, swaying to the music with an ease that quickly became the evening’s most-discussed moment. Footage circulating online shows her fully absorbed in the performance before turning to Harry, seated beside her, to share a brief exchange. He responded with a subdued smile before she turned back toward the stage, continuing to move to the beat. The clip, though brief, was enough to reignite the near-constant online conversation that follows the couple’s every public move, this time centered on Markle’s dance and how visible it was in the crowd.

Fans Split Over the Viral Clip
The footage split opinion almost immediately after it began circulating. Some critics accused Markle of drawing unnecessary attention to herself, suggesting she stood out compared with other guests who stayed seated, while others speculated that Harry’s quieter demeanor in the clip hinted at discomfort with the moment. A handful of commenters went further, questioning the authenticity of the couple’s public affection and framing the dance as a performance for cameras rather than a genuine moment of fun.
Not everyone piled on, though. A number of supporters pushed back hard against the criticism, arguing that Markle owed no explanation for enjoying herself at a party and accusing detractors of recycling familiar media narratives rather than reacting to anything unusual. The gap between the two camps only fueled further engagement, with the clip racking up shares across social platforms well after the event had ended.
